HomeSort by: relevance | last modified time | path
    Searched defs:cia (Results 1 - 25 of 32) sorted by relevancy

1 2

  /src/external/gpl3/gdb/dist/sim/common/
sim-run.c 37 sim_cia cia; local
41 cia = CPU_PC_GET (cpu);
44 instruction_word insn = IMEM32 (cia);
45 cia = idecode_issue (sd, insn, cia);
49 CPU_PC_SET (cpu, cia);
sim-n-core.h 72 sim_cia cia,
149 sim_cia cia,
164 mapping = sim_core_find_mapping (core, map, addr, N, read_transfer, 1 /*abort*/, cpu, cia);
171 sim_cpu_hw_io_read_buffer (cpu, cia, mapping->device, &data, mapping->space, addr, N);
181 sim_core_trace_M (cpu, cia, __LINE__, read_transfer, map, addr, val, N);
193 sim_cia cia,
200 return sim_core_read_aligned_N (cpu, cia, map, addr & ~alignment);
202 return sim_core_read_aligned_N (cpu, cia, map, addr);
207 SIM_CORE_SIGNAL (CPU_STATE (cpu), cpu, cia, map, N, addr, local
213 SIM_CORE_SIGNAL (CPU_STATE (cpu), cpu, cia, map, N, addr local
224 sim_engine_abort (CPU_STATE (cpu), cpu, cia, local
228 sim_engine_abort (CPU_STATE (cpu), cpu, cia, local
249 SIM_CORE_SIGNAL (CPU_STATE (cpu), cpu, cia, map, N, addr, local
326 SIM_CORE_SIGNAL (CPU_STATE (cpu), cpu, cia, map, N, addr, local
333 SIM_CORE_SIGNAL (CPU_STATE (cpu), cpu, cia, map, N, addr, local
344 sim_engine_abort (CPU_STATE (cpu), cpu, cia, local
349 sim_engine_abort (CPU_STATE (cpu), cpu, cia, local
374 SIM_CORE_SIGNAL (CPU_STATE (cpu), cpu, cia, map, N, addr, local
    [all...]
sim-watch.c 385 address_word cia = CPU_PC_GET (cpu); local
386 sim_engine_halt (sd, cpu, NULL, cia, sim_stopped, SIM_SIGTRAP);
sim-core.c 105 #define SIM_CORE_SIGNAL(SD,CPU,CIA,MAP,NR_BYTES,ADDR,TRANSFER,ERROR) \
106 sim_core_signal ((SD), (CPU), (CIA), (MAP), (NR_BYTES), (ADDR), (TRANSFER), (ERROR))
113 sim_cia cia,
121 address_word ip = CIA_ADDR (cia);
127 sim_engine_halt (sd, cpu, NULL, cia, sim_stopped, SIM_SIGSEGV);
132 sim_engine_halt (sd, cpu, NULL, cia, sim_stopped, SIM_SIGBUS);
135 sim_engine_abort (sd, cpu, cia,
429 sim_cia cia)
444 SIM_CORE_SIGNAL (CPU_STATE (cpu), cpu, cia, map, nr_bytes, addr, transfer, local
551 sim_cia cia = cpu ? CPU_PC_GET (cpu) : NULL_CIA local
609 sim_cia cia = cpu ? CPU_PC_GET (cpu) : NULL_CIA; local
    [all...]
sim-hw.c 47 sim_cia cia; member in struct:sim_hw
339 /* CPU: The simulation is running and the current CPU/CIA
344 sim_cia cia,
353 STATE_HW (sd)->cia = cia;
355 sim_engine_abort (sd, cpu, cia, "broken CPU read");
360 sim_cia cia,
369 STATE_HW (sd)->cia = cia;
371 sim_engine_abort (sd, cpu, cia, "broken CPU write")
    [all...]
sim-events.c 1030 sim_cia cia = sim_pc_get (cpu); local
1032 if (to_do->is_within == (cia >= to_do->lb64 && cia <= to_do->ub64))
  /src/external/gpl3/gdb.old/dist/sim/common/
sim-run.c 37 sim_cia cia; local
41 cia = CPU_PC_GET (cpu);
44 instruction_word insn = IMEM32 (cia);
45 cia = idecode_issue (sd, insn, cia);
49 CPU_PC_SET (cpu, cia);
sim-n-core.h 72 sim_cia cia,
149 sim_cia cia,
164 mapping = sim_core_find_mapping (core, map, addr, N, read_transfer, 1 /*abort*/, cpu, cia);
171 sim_cpu_hw_io_read_buffer (cpu, cia, mapping->device, &data, mapping->space, addr, N);
181 sim_core_trace_M (cpu, cia, __LINE__, read_transfer, map, addr, val, N);
193 sim_cia cia,
200 return sim_core_read_aligned_N (cpu, cia, map, addr & ~alignment);
202 return sim_core_read_aligned_N (cpu, cia, map, addr);
207 SIM_CORE_SIGNAL (CPU_STATE (cpu), cpu, cia, map, N, addr, local
213 SIM_CORE_SIGNAL (CPU_STATE (cpu), cpu, cia, map, N, addr local
224 sim_engine_abort (CPU_STATE (cpu), cpu, cia, local
228 sim_engine_abort (CPU_STATE (cpu), cpu, cia, local
249 SIM_CORE_SIGNAL (CPU_STATE (cpu), cpu, cia, map, N, addr, local
326 SIM_CORE_SIGNAL (CPU_STATE (cpu), cpu, cia, map, N, addr, local
333 SIM_CORE_SIGNAL (CPU_STATE (cpu), cpu, cia, map, N, addr, local
344 sim_engine_abort (CPU_STATE (cpu), cpu, cia, local
349 sim_engine_abort (CPU_STATE (cpu), cpu, cia, local
374 SIM_CORE_SIGNAL (CPU_STATE (cpu), cpu, cia, map, N, addr, local
    [all...]
sim-watch.c 385 address_word cia = CPU_PC_GET (cpu); local
386 sim_engine_halt (sd, cpu, NULL, cia, sim_stopped, SIM_SIGTRAP);
sim-core.c 105 #define SIM_CORE_SIGNAL(SD,CPU,CIA,MAP,NR_BYTES,ADDR,TRANSFER,ERROR) \
106 sim_core_signal ((SD), (CPU), (CIA), (MAP), (NR_BYTES), (ADDR), (TRANSFER), (ERROR))
113 sim_cia cia,
121 address_word ip = CIA_ADDR (cia);
127 sim_engine_halt (sd, cpu, NULL, cia, sim_stopped, SIM_SIGSEGV);
132 sim_engine_halt (sd, cpu, NULL, cia, sim_stopped, SIM_SIGBUS);
135 sim_engine_abort (sd, cpu, cia,
429 sim_cia cia)
444 SIM_CORE_SIGNAL (CPU_STATE (cpu), cpu, cia, map, nr_bytes, addr, transfer, local
551 sim_cia cia = cpu ? CPU_PC_GET (cpu) : NULL_CIA local
609 sim_cia cia = cpu ? CPU_PC_GET (cpu) : NULL_CIA; local
    [all...]
sim-hw.c 47 sim_cia cia; member in struct:sim_hw
339 /* CPU: The simulation is running and the current CPU/CIA
344 sim_cia cia,
353 STATE_HW (sd)->cia = cia;
355 sim_engine_abort (sd, cpu, cia, "broken CPU read");
360 sim_cia cia,
369 STATE_HW (sd)->cia = cia;
371 sim_engine_abort (sd, cpu, cia, "broken CPU write")
    [all...]
  /src/external/gpl3/gdb/dist/sim/mips/
m16run.c 40 address_word cia = CPU_PC_GET (cpu); local
50 if ((cia & 1))
52 m16_instruction_word instruction_0 = IMEM16 (cia);
53 nia = m16_idecode_issue (sd, instruction_0, cia);
57 m32_instruction_word instruction_0 = IMEM32 (cia);
58 nia = m32_idecode_issue (sd, instruction_0, cia);
62 cia = nia;
67 CPU_PC_SET (CPU, cia);
69 cia = CPU_PC_GET (CPU);
micromipsrun.c 45 address_word cia,
50 micromips16_instruction_word instruction_0 = IMEM16_MICROMIPS (cia);
53 return micromips16_idecode_issue (sd, instruction_0, cia);
56 micromips32_instruction_word instruction_0 = IMEM32_MICROMIPS (cia);
57 return micromips32_idecode_issue (sd, instruction_0, cia);
62 micromips16_instruction_word instruction_0 = IMEM16_MICROMIPS (cia);
65 return micromips16_idecode_issue (sd, instruction_0, cia);
67 sim_engine_abort (sd, cpu, cia,
72 micromips32_instruction_word instruction_0 = IMEM32_MICROMIPS (cia);
73 return micromips32_idecode_issue (sd, instruction_0, cia);
86 micromips32_instruction_address cia = CPU_PC_GET (cpu); local
    [all...]
dv-tx3904cpu.c 146 address_word cia = CPU_PC_GET (cpu); local
  /src/external/gpl3/gdb.old/dist/sim/mips/
m16run.c 40 address_word cia = CPU_PC_GET (cpu); local
50 if ((cia & 1))
52 m16_instruction_word instruction_0 = IMEM16 (cia);
53 nia = m16_idecode_issue (sd, instruction_0, cia);
57 m32_instruction_word instruction_0 = IMEM32 (cia);
58 nia = m32_idecode_issue (sd, instruction_0, cia);
62 cia = nia;
67 CPU_PC_SET (CPU, cia);
69 cia = CPU_PC_GET (CPU);
micromipsrun.c 45 address_word cia,
50 micromips16_instruction_word instruction_0 = IMEM16_MICROMIPS (cia);
53 return micromips16_idecode_issue (sd, instruction_0, cia);
56 micromips32_instruction_word instruction_0 = IMEM32_MICROMIPS (cia);
57 return micromips32_idecode_issue (sd, instruction_0, cia);
62 micromips16_instruction_word instruction_0 = IMEM16_MICROMIPS (cia);
65 return micromips16_idecode_issue (sd, instruction_0, cia);
67 sim_engine_abort (sd, cpu, cia,
72 micromips32_instruction_word instruction_0 = IMEM32_MICROMIPS (cia);
73 return micromips32_idecode_issue (sd, instruction_0, cia);
86 micromips32_instruction_address cia = CPU_PC_GET (cpu); local
    [all...]
dv-tx3904cpu.c 146 address_word cia = CPU_PC_GET (cpu); local
  /src/external/gpl3/gdb/dist/sim/cris/
dv-cris_900000xx.c 39 sim_cia cia = CPU_PC_GET (cpu); local
42 return cris_break_13_handler (cpu, 1, 0, 0, 0, 0, 0, 0, cia);
45 return cris_break_13_handler (cpu, 1, 34, 0, 0, 0, 0, 0, cia);
48 sim_core_signal (sd, cpu, cia, 0, nr_bytes, addr,
  /src/external/gpl3/gdb.old/dist/sim/cris/
dv-cris_900000xx.c 39 sim_cia cia = CPU_PC_GET (cpu); local
42 return cris_break_13_handler (cpu, 1, 0, 0, 0, 0, 0, 0, cia);
45 return cris_break_13_handler (cpu, 1, 34, 0, 0, 0, 0, 0, cia);
48 sim_core_signal (sd, cpu, cia, 0, nr_bytes, addr,
  /src/external/gpl3/gdb/dist/sim/ppc/
interrupts.c 97 unsigned_word cia,
108 cpu_error(processor, cia,
109 "double interrupt - MSR[RI] bit clear when attempting to deliver interrupt, cia=0x%lx, msr=0x%lx; srr0=0x%lx(cia), srr1=0x%lx(msr); trap-vector=0x%lx, trap-msr=0x%lx",
110 (unsigned long)cia,
117 SRR0 = (spreg)(cia);
121 cpu_synchronize_context(processor, cia);
129 unsigned_word cia)
135 cpu_error(processor, cia, "machine-check interrupt");
138 TRACE(trace_interrupts, ("machine-check interrupt - cia=0x%lx\n"
452 unsigned_word cia = cpu_get_program_counter(processor); local
460 unsigned_word cia = cpu_get_program_counter(processor); local
468 unsigned_word cia = cpu_get_program_counter(processor); local
    [all...]
emul_generic.c 36 unsigned_word cia)
40 (long)cia,
50 unsigned_word cia)
102 unsigned_word cia)
110 processor, cia);
157 unsigned_word cia)
161 processor, cia);
169 unsigned_word cia)
174 processor, cia); local
183 unsigned_word cia)
190 processor, cia); local
    [all...]
  /src/external/gpl3/gdb.old/dist/sim/ppc/
interrupts.c 97 unsigned_word cia,
108 cpu_error(processor, cia,
109 "double interrupt - MSR[RI] bit clear when attempting to deliver interrupt, cia=0x%lx, msr=0x%lx; srr0=0x%lx(cia), srr1=0x%lx(msr); trap-vector=0x%lx, trap-msr=0x%lx",
110 (unsigned long)cia,
117 SRR0 = (spreg)(cia);
121 cpu_synchronize_context(processor, cia);
129 unsigned_word cia)
135 cpu_error(processor, cia, "machine-check interrupt");
138 TRACE(trace_interrupts, ("machine-check interrupt - cia=0x%lx\n"
452 unsigned_word cia = cpu_get_program_counter(processor); local
460 unsigned_word cia = cpu_get_program_counter(processor); local
468 unsigned_word cia = cpu_get_program_counter(processor); local
    [all...]
emul_generic.c 36 unsigned_word cia)
40 (long)cia,
50 unsigned_word cia)
102 unsigned_word cia)
110 processor, cia);
157 unsigned_word cia)
161 processor, cia);
169 unsigned_word cia)
174 processor, cia); local
183 unsigned_word cia)
190 processor, cia); local
    [all...]
  /src/external/gpl3/gdb/dist/sim/ft32/
interp.c 118 address_word cia = CPU_PC_GET (cpu); local
124 return sim_core_read_aligned_1 (cpu, cia, read_map, ea);
126 return sim_core_read_aligned_2 (cpu, cia, read_map, ea);
128 return sim_core_read_aligned_4 (cpu, cia, read_map, ea);
139 address_word cia = CPU_PC_GET (cpu); local
145 sim_core_write_aligned_1 (cpu, cia, write_map, ea, v);
148 sim_core_write_aligned_2 (cpu, cia, write_map, ea, v);
151 sim_core_write_aligned_4 (cpu, cia, write_map, ea, v);
  /src/external/gpl3/gdb/dist/sim/moxie/
interp.c 47 ((sim_core_read_aligned_1 (scpu, cia, read_map, addr) << 24) \
48 + (sim_core_read_aligned_1 (scpu, cia, read_map, addr+1) << 16) \
49 + (sim_core_read_aligned_1 (scpu, cia, read_map, addr+2) << 8) \
50 + (sim_core_read_aligned_1 (scpu, cia, read_map, addr+3)))
55 ((sim_core_read_aligned_1 (scpu, cia, read_map, addr) << 8) \
56 + (sim_core_read_aligned_1 (scpu, cia, read_map, addr+1))) << 16) >> 16)
151 address_word cia = CPU_PC_GET (scpu); local
153 sim_core_write_aligned_1 (scpu, cia, write_map, x, v);
161 address_word cia = CPU_PC_GET (scpu); local
163 sim_core_write_aligned_2 (scpu, cia, write_map, x, v)
171 address_word cia = CPU_PC_GET (scpu); local
181 address_word cia = CPU_PC_GET (scpu); local
191 address_word cia = CPU_PC_GET (scpu); local
201 address_word cia = CPU_PC_GET (scpu); local
248 address_word cia = CPU_PC_GET (scpu); local
    [all...]

Completed in 41 milliseconds

1 2